The growing use of high-energy devices in homes and companies has actually developed a high need for knowledgeable Hurstville electricians who can update residential or commercial properties to three-phase power systems. Lots of buildings now need more than the standard single-phase connection to support heavy-duty devices like industrial cooking areas, fast electric lorry battery chargers, and big cooling systems. A qualified Hurstville Level 2 Electrician can assess a structure's electrical requirements and design a customized upgrade to a three-phase system, supplying a more steady and efficient power supply. This specific work, that includes customizing service merges and installing sophisticated metering devices, is beyond the scope of a routine electrician and requires the expertise of a licensed Level 2 expert. By carrying out these complicated upgrades, a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ician enables homes to safely and dependably support the demands of modern-day technology, eliminating the threats of power overloads and voltage interruptions.

Security and the resolution of problem notices form a core part of the service offered by a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ician. If a network supplier determines a hazardous condition at your residential or commercial property, such as a degraded point of accessory or an out-of-date switchboard, they might release a defect notice that requires immediate attention to avoid disconnection. In these immediate situations, a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ician acts as the essential link in between the house owner and the energy supplier, carrying out the required repairs to bring back the system to a safe operating state. They are experts in identifying signs of thermal damage in customer mains and can carry out live-line work to change faulty parts before they cause a significant catastrophe. Dealing with a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ician warranties that the work is backed by a compliance certificate, which is an important legal document in Australia for insurance coverage and property valuation functions.
